C++ features by examples
Modules
Here is a list of all modules:
[detail level
1
2
3
4
5
]
C++ OOP patterns
Some examples in C++
▼
Design patterns skeleton examples
Software design patterns
Creational
Creational patterns
Structural
Structural patterns
▼
Behavioral
Behavioral patterns
Visitor
Visitor pattern
▼
Architectural
Architectural patterns
Publish–subscribe pattern
Publish–subscribe pattern
Concurrency
Concurrency patterns
▼
C++ examples by version
From recent to oldest
▼
C++20 examples
Language
▼
Templates
▼
Concepts
'Requires' clause and expression
Concept definitions
Coroutines
Other
▼
C++17 examples
▼
Template
Template argument deduction
Template parameters
▼
Lambda
Constexpr lambda
Lambda capture this by value
Threads
▼
Language
language
Folding
fold
Qualified nested namespace
namespace
Structured bindings
New attributes
fallthrough
,
nodiscard
,
maybe_unused
Library
Other
▼
C++14 examples
Deduction
Other
Lambda
▼
C++11 examples
Language
Lambda
More complex Lambdas
Threads
▼
C++03 examples
C++03 / C++98
Language
Generated by
1.9.3